Iconic Westport Landmark:
COLEY MILL AND BARN
Coley Ville, also known as Coley Town was established as a village in the late 1600s and early 1700s. The prominent family was the Coley Family who owned a farm and the village grew to support it. It had a village green, a school house, a blacksmith, a shoemaker, stables, and it all centered around this village mill.

This iconic property functioned as a mill for many years in the 17th and 18th Hundreds.
